Factors Influencing Parking Availability
Several dynamic elements impact parking availability on any given day, including seasonal tourism peaks, cruise ship schedules, and large conventions at the Orange County Convention Center. Rainy summer afternoons and holiday travel windows consistently drive higher demand for covered parking options. Monitoring these patterns allows savvy travelers to book in advance and secure preferred locations near terminal entrances.
Seasonal tourism fluctuations, particularly during spring break and winter holidays.
Special events at the convention center and nearby stadiums.
Weather conditions that increase reliance on covered parking.
Operational adjustments during airport construction or maintenance.
Variations in airline schedules and flight cancellation rates.

Tips for Securing Parking During High Demand
When forecasts indicate near-capacity conditions, proactive reservation becomes essential. Booking parking online 48 to 72 hours ahead typically guarantees a spot and often unlocks early-bird discounts. Travelers should also consider split parking strategies, such as parking farther away and using ride-share or public transit for the final leg to the terminal.
